STREET vendors can often be seen occupying the roads of Solan, putting motorists at risk. The authorities should reserve specific spaces for such vendors. Rajnish, Solan

Broken sewerage line irks residents of Navbahar

A sewerage line in the Navbahar locality of Shimla is broken. Due to this, contaminated water has been flowing on to the road. As a result, people here have to deal with the foul smell that the water gives off. This could lead to a spread of various diseases. The authorities concerned should repair this line as soon as possible in the interest of the area residents. Gaurav, Shimla

Irregular potable water supply

DRINKING water supply has been erratic in many areas of Shimla. Due to this, people here have been facing a lot of inconvenience. The MC authorities are requested to ensure regular water supply in the town. Jeevan Singh, Shimla
